Question

A 2.00-kg solid, uniform ball of radius 0.100 m is released from rest at point A in
Figure P8.59, its center of gravity a distance of 1.50 m above the ground. The ball rolls
without slipping to the bottom of an incline and back up to point B where it is
launched vertically into the air. The ball rises to its maximum height hmax at point C.
At point B, find the ball’s (a) translational speed and (b) rotational speed ωB. At point
C, find the ball’s (c) rotational speed ωC and (d) maximum height of its center of
gravity
